Puppet Theater with puppets and scenery
Beskrivelse
This pocket-sized puppet theatre has everything needed to put on a fun pint-size puppet show. Not only that, but your little stage manager has full creative control with colour-your-own puppets and scenery backdrops. Great for gifts, party favours, or even as screen-free entertainment while travelling. Portable: fits in the palm of your hand No purge waste: all parts print using filament swaps (no AMS needed) Quick and easy print: tested until perfect, the whole model (puppets and theatre) prints in only 3.5h Backdrop slot for quick scenery changes: upcycle a business card* or use the PDF of ready-to-colour scenes (see Downloads) Packs away completely: puppets stow inside the stage while backdrops go in the rear pocket. Customizable: add your own text to a special name plate (see below for more information) * Why business cards? They're a common and easy-to-find source of sturdy paper. The slot is specifically designed to fit any one of the many different sizes used around the world. Special Considerations – please read first ⚠️ Small parts. Choking hazard. Not suitable for very young children. Adult supervision is highly recommended and enjoyable. ⚠️ Glue required. The stage front should be glued on with an appropriate adhesive. I use gel CA glue (aka super glue) and find that it works for my purposes. However, I'd rather you did your own research to make an informed choice. Just don't use hot glue :) ⚠️ Permanent marker works best for colouring the puppets. Pencil crayons are also “okay” with the caveat that they can rub off in areas and aren't as bright. Water-based markers are NOT recommended. They smear, run, remain sticky, and just generally make a mess. Consider pre-colouring puppets if this will be a gift to a child that is old enough for the theatre but not so old that they will ink themselves up :) ⚠️ Clean build plate required. Small details will get dragged if the plate isn't clean. Print profiles contain settings which will help adhesion but cannot perform miracles 😥. Please see this wiki article for correct plate washing procedure. If you scale up the models yourself, I make no guarantees of model quality or fit as I haven't tested it myself. Additionally, you will need to edit the filament swap settings to take in to account any changes to scale. 2. Before You Print Printing is fairly straight-forward but there are a few things to keep in mind. ⚠️Multicolour parts use filament swaps and NOT the paint bucket. See and edit colour changes in Studio NOT Handy (the app). Be sure to select the right plate or profile for your setting. They will be marked as follows: “AMS Only” → AMS will auto change filament. “Manual Swap” → printer will pause and wait for user to change filament. Unfamiliar with filament swap printing? See Detailed Print Guide below. A1, A1 Mini or other bed slinger style printers: the theatre is taller than its footprint is wide and may be susceptible to coming loose. If in doubt, use the “with brim” plate in the profile. Plate type: Textured. While you can use a smooth plate, the fit of the parts may be affected. Theatre Body: can be customized with a name; download the special 3mf using the “Download STL/CAD Files” button and edit in Studio. Lid: Print in Regular size to start. If fit is too tight or loose, reprint using one of the other sizes if needed. Still not fitting? More info below. Suggested Filaments The models in the photos were primarily printed using Bambu PLA Basic (Indigo Purple) and PLA Galaxy (Purple).
